Recognizing Core Values ​and Shared Beliefs

Identifying whether a potential partner shares your core values and beliefs is crucial for long-term compatibility. ​These⁢ fundamental aspects often form the backbone of a relationship,⁣ guiding decisions‍ and behaviors. Start by reflecting on what truly matters to you. Consider elements such as:

  • Family ‌and ⁣Relationships: How do ⁣you both view family ⁣dynamics⁤ and the importance of friendships?
  • Career and Ambitions: Are your professional goals ‌aligned, ​and how do ⁣they impact⁣ your‌ personal lives?
  • Ethics and Morality: Do you share similar views ‌on⁢ right and ⁤wrong?
  • Lifestyle and Interests: How do ‍your daily habits and hobbies ​mesh together?

Engage in open discussions about these topics to understand each⁣ other’s perspectives. It’s essential to​ approach these‌ conversations with⁢ an ​open ‍mind and genuine curiosity, ⁤allowing both partners to express their thoughts freely. Recognizing and respecting differences while celebrating shared ⁢beliefs can create a ⁢strong foundation for your relationship.

Exploring ‍Emotional and Communication Styles

Understanding how you‍ and your partner express ⁤emotions and communicate can be​ a cornerstone of a harmonious relationship. Different styles can lead to misunderstandings or ‌can complement each​ other‍ beautifully. To navigate this,⁣ consider the following:

  • Active Listening: Pay ⁢attention⁣ to how your partner listens ‍to you. Are they truly⁢ engaged, or do‌ they often‌ interrupt? ⁢Effective ⁣listening can be a ⁤sign of empathy and understanding.
  • Expression of Emotions: Observe how they handle emotions. Are they open ​and expressive, ⁢or do they tend to keep things bottled up?⁢ Recognizing these patterns can help ‍in⁢ managing​ conflicts ⁢and fostering intimacy.
  • Conflict‌ Resolution: Notice ‌their⁣ approach to disagreements.⁤ Do they prefer ⁣to⁣ talk things out​ immediately,‍ or do they need ⁣time to cool off? Compatibility in conflict resolution styles can lead‍ to more⁤ productive discussions.

By⁣ being mindful of these aspects, you can ​better gauge whether your emotional⁣ and communication ​styles align, paving the way for a ‍potentially fulfilling long-term partnership.

Assessing Life Goals and Future‍ Aspirations

When exploring the⁤ depths ⁣of​ a potential long-term partnership, it’s crucial to ‍delve ⁢into ‌each other’s life goals ​and ⁣future ⁢aspirations. These elements are the compass that ‌guides our ⁣journey, influencing decisions,‌ lifestyle, and even values. Understanding‍ and ⁣aligning these aspirations can be a‌ cornerstone⁤ for a harmonious relationship. Here are⁤ some ⁤key⁢ areas to consider:

  • Career⁢ Ambitions: Are both partners​ driven by similar ‍career goals, or is one⁢ more focused on work-life balance?⁢ Discussing career trajectories can‌ reveal potential conflicts or synergies.
  • Family Planning: ​The‌ desire to⁢ have children, or not, is a significant life goal. Ensure both partners are on the same page regarding​ family size and parenting philosophies.
  • Lifestyle Choices: Consider ‌whether you both‌ envision a similar lifestyle, whether it’s a life ⁣filled with travel, a⁤ home in ‌the suburbs, or something ⁢entirely unique.
  • Personal ‍Growth: How ⁣do you both⁤ view personal development? ‌Sharing interests in self-improvement can lead to mutual growth and a deeper ⁤connection.
  • Retirement Dreams: Aligning ‍visions for the‍ future, such as retirement plans, can⁣ help in understanding ⁢long-term‍ compatibility.

By engaging in open‍ and honest conversations⁤ about these​ aspirations,⁢ couples can better navigate their journey ⁤together, fostering a​ relationship built ⁣on mutual understanding and shared dreams.

Understanding Conflict Resolution and Problem-Solving Skills

Recognizing ‌how‍ a potential ​partner approaches‌ disagreements and challenges is crucial⁣ for gauging compatibility. Effective conflict resolution and ‍ problem-solving skills can significantly influence the health and longevity of a relationship. ⁣Here are some key aspects to consider:

  • Communication Style: Does your partner express their thoughts clearly and listen actively? The ability⁢ to​ engage in ⁤open⁢ and honest dialogue is vital.
  • Emotional⁤ Regulation: ​Observe how they handle stress and emotions ​during conflicts. A partner who remains calm ‌and⁣ composed can⁣ foster a more stable environment.
  • Collaborative Approach: ‌ Pay attention to whether they seek win-win solutions or if they are more inclined towards compromise or dominance. A⁣ collaborative‌ mindset often leads to more⁣ harmonious resolutions.
  • Willingness to Apologize: Acknowledging mistakes and offering genuine apologies⁢ can indicate ⁣maturity and a‍ commitment ⁣to growth.

Understanding these ⁣dynamics can help you determine if⁤ your potential partner possesses ⁢the necessary ‌skills⁢ to ⁣navigate life’s ⁤inevitable‌ challenges together.
